OnlineTrainingIO

JQUERY

About JQuery

  • Effects & Animations
  • DOM Manipulation
  • Learn AJAX
  • Event Handling
  • Form Validation

What are the objectives of JQuery Course?

  • Design and build rich interactive web applications.
  • Creating interactive user interface.
  • The jQuery library makes it easy to manipulate a page of HTML after it’s displayed by the browser.
  • It also provides tools that help you listen for a user to interact with your page, tools that help you create animations in your page, and tools that let you communicate with a server without reloading the page.

What are the prerequisites of JQuery Course?

  • Web developers who need to get to grips with key jQuery functionality in order to develop rich interactive web applications.
  • Working knowledge in HTML, CSS and JavaScript

 

Certification

  • JQuery Certification.

 

JQUERY Course Outline

 JQUERY FUNDAMENTALS

  • Traversing HTML with the jQuery() function
  • Introducing the Sizzle CSS selector engine
  • Matching nodes by element name, ID, class, position, content, behavior and context
  • Chaining calls to the jQuery() function
  • Manipulating the Document Object Model (DOM) for Cross-Browser DHTML

 ADDING AND REPLACING CONTENT WITH JQUERY

  • Updating, adding and deleting element content
  • Inserting nodes into the DOM and manipulating parents and siblings

 DYNAMICALLY ASSIGNING CSS PROPERTIES

  • Adding and removing CSS rules and classes
  • Controlling element size and position

 CREATING ACCESSIBLE, UNOBTRUSIVE JAVASCRIPT

  • Leveraging the .ready() method
  • Assigning event handlers programmatically
  • Animating Web Pages with jQuery Effects

 ENHANCING PAGES WITH ANIMATIONS

  • Controlling visibility with .hide(), .show() and .toggle()
  • Combining animations and responding to callbacks
  • Leveraging object literals to control animations
  • Developing custom animations with .animate()
  • Building Responsive Pages with Ajax

 UPDATING PAGE COMPONENTS ASYNCHRONOUSLY

  • Downloading HTML with the .load() method
  • Calling web services with .get() and .post()
  • Replacing callbacks with chained deferred objects
  • Combining Ajax calls with .when() and .then()

 CONVERTING SERIALIZED SERVER DATA TO HTML

  • Retrieving JSON with .getJSON()
  • Returning and parsing XML with .ajax()
  • Designing User-Friendly Forms

 EXPLORING JQUERY TOOLS FOR FORMS MANIPULATION

  • Selecting and setting focus on the first element
  • Responding to focus and blur events
  • Providing real-time feedback via keyboard events
  • Integrating a validation plugin
  • Extending jQuery with Plugins

 INTEGRATING POPULAR PLUGINS

  • Leveraging contributions from the jQuery community
  • Extracting embedded data from semantic HTML
  • Manipulating images with slideshows and carousels

 DEVELOPING JQUERY PLUGINS

  • Conforming to best practices and naming conventions
  • Handling multiple elements
  • Enabling method chaining
  • Aliasing $ to avoid namespace conflicts
  • Consuming object literals to override defaults
  • Creating Sophisticated User Interfaces with jQuery UI

 INTEGRATING WIDGETS FOR HIGHLY INTERACTIVE WEB APPLICATIONS

  • Optimizing screen real estate with accordions and tabs
  • Adding resizable, floating windows with dialog
  • Providing input assistance with autocomplete

 IMPLEMENTING EFFECTS

  • Creating color animations with .animate()
  • Leveraging complex animation easings and effects

 ADDING WEB 2.0 FUNCTIONALITY

  • Resizing HTML elements
  • Building drag-and-drop user interfaces
error:
Scroll to Top